I’ve never been one to be very good at applying eyeliner. I’m a bit of a perfectionist some times so when I do use eyeliner it drives me crazy if there’s even the slightest imperfection. With that being said, I chose not to wear eye liner for a very long time, and even now it’s not in my every day makeup pile.
But for those special occasions when I do want to wear liner or have a winged eye, I needed an eyeliner that was very user friendly.
In the past I had used a simple automatic crayon pencil. Then for a while I was in love with Urban Decay’s 24/7 Glide-on Eye Pencil. And after that I heard Jaclyn Hill rave about Maybelline’s Eye Studio Gel Eyeliner and I tried that for a few.
Then I just gave up all together. I never felt that an eyeliner did what I was expecting it to do and I also felt it was a waste of money because of this.
I had heard so many positive comments about the Kat Von D Tattoo Liner that I finally caved and bought it. I had yet to try an eyeliner in this form and I was hoping that it was exactly what I needed. AND IT WAS! 😀
As with everything, practice makes perfect. But I easily learned how to work with this liner to create the eye look that I had been wanting and striving for this entire time!
